Senior Recruiter @ netPolarity (A Saicon Consultants Inc. company) | Corporate Recruiting, Internal Recruitment Title: Senior GRC Analyst Duration: 6 Months (Potential to be extended) Rate: $70/Hour on W2 Job Description: Senior Security Governance, Risk, Compliance (GRC) Analyst Reporting to the Director of Information Security, Governance, Risk, and Compliance, the Senior GRC Analyst will contribute to the development and operational execution of the program, including risk management and compliance with standards and regulations such as ISO27001 and EU GDPR. Responsibilities: Support the GRC operating model and the service-oriented customer engagement model. Provide Cybersecurity Risk Management leadership and operational delivery of the program. Support GRC capabilities, such as compliance and audit management, policy management, security awareness training, third-party risk management, and metrics and reporting. Assist in managing security compliance programs and activities that support various compliance regulations. Perform risk assessments to address security threats, changes to systems and/or applications, process improvement initiatives, supplier assessments (including downstream outsourcers) and other requests from the business. Collaborate with various operational and business teams to complete assessments, develop treatment plans, and drive remediation items to closure. Maintain accurate reporting of remediation activities to bring appropriate visibility to stakeholders and leadership. Monitor the security risk profiles and events of our suppliers to objectively determine high-risk suppliers that require additional review and treatment plans. Establish and maintain security metrics and reporting. Respond to customer security/compliance questionnaires. Act as security risk management “ambassador” to internal customers. Accountable for: The use of defined risk methodologies and best practices to perform IT/Security assessments. Responsible for the planning, scoping, tracking, and execution of these assessments. Driving remediation activities from identification, treatment plan, remediation, and closure. Hold owners accountable for the delivery of the remediation solution within the agreed-upon/reasonable SLA. Operations and improvements of security audit and compliance programs to support various compliance regulations. Operationalization of a metrics and reporting function to continually report on meaningful security, risk, and compliance metrics for operational and executive management. Support the automation of KRIs and KPI reporting that align with operational/business risk areas and corporate risk. Qualifications: Candidate must have at least 7 years of working experience in governance, risk, and compliance and/or information security and risk management, and at least 5 years in risk management. Functional knowledge of the CISSP security domains and information security industry standards and best practices. Functional knowledge of applicable security regulatory and compliance requirements (SOX, GDPR). Functional knowledge of ISMS governance models and analysis of certification reports (i.e., ISO 27001, SOC, CAIQ), information security roles, and security controls. Ability to communicate risk methodologies and concepts to business units and IT teams. Demonstrated experience with controls definition, development, implementation, and assessment. Strong interpersonal skills and ability to work effectively with diverse and globally distributed teams. Strong attention to detail, project management, and organizational skills. Self-starter with the ability to effectively manage independent workloads asynchronously with stakeholders across multiple time zones. Ability to independently lead program areas and c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ality results according to well-defined planning. Define and communicate program and activity plans and roadmaps and effectively collaborate with all business and IT groups to achieve goals.
